1. Is the entertainment suitable for my child’s age?

Children of different ages enjoy very different things.

A 3-year-old may love colourful props, balloons and simple, funny moments.
A 6-year-old may enjoy magic, games and being part of the show. Older children may prefer activities that feel more interactive, active or hands-on.

As a simple guide:

  • Ages 3 to 5: simple magic, balloons, face painting and short interactive moments usually work well.
  • Ages 5 to 10: magic shows, games hosting and balloon sculpting are popular choices.
  • Ages 10 and above: games, workshops, caricature, close-up magic or creative activities may be more suitable.

Before booking, it is always helpful to share your child’s age and the age range of the guests. A good party entertainment provider should be able to recommend something that suits the children, not just offer the same package to every party.

Sometimes, the best activity is not the biggest or most expensive one. It is the one that fits the children in the room.

3. Can the entertainer handle the number of children attending?

A party with 10 children feels very different from a party with 25 or 30 children.

For a small party, one main activity may be enough. For a bigger group, you may need something more structured so the children know where to gather, when to sit, and when to participate.

Useful questions to ask include:

  • How many children is this activity suitable for?
  • Will one entertainer be enough?
  • Can the show or games be adjusted for a larger group?
  • Would you recommend an add-on activity?

This is especially useful for condo function rooms, school parties, preschool celebrations and family events, where the number of children can sometimes grow quite quickly.

A good entertainer should be comfortable guiding the children without making the party feel too strict or too chaotic.

4. Will the entertainment work at my venue?

In Singapore, children’s birthday parties are often held at home, condo function rooms, preschools, schools, restaurants, event rooms and indoor play spaces.

Each venue has a different setup. Some are spacious, while others are cosy. Some have tables and chairs already arranged. Some have limited space after food, balloons and decorations are set up.

Before booking, share these details with the entertainer:

  • Venue type: home, condo, school, preschool or event space
  • Indoor or outdoor setting
  • Estimated number of children
  • Available space for the activity
  • Any venue rules or restrictions

For smaller spaces, activities like magic shows and balloon sculpting usually work well as they are more mobile. And they do not need a huge area like games, but it is still helpful to keep a clear space for the children.

6. How should the entertainment fit into the party flow?

A good party flow can make the whole celebration feel much easier.

Children’s parties usually work better when there is a simple structure. It helps the children know what is happening, and it also helps parents feel less rushed.

A simple 2-hour party flow could look like this:

  • Guest arrival
    Balloon sculpting, face painting or free play
  • Main entertainment
    Magic show or games hosting
  • Cake cutting
    Birthday song, photos and cake
  • Final activity
    Goodie bags or casual play

Of course, every party is different. Some parents prefer cake cutting earlier. Some venues have strict timing. Some children need more time to warm up.

The important thing is to ask where the entertainment segment fits best. For example, a magic show usually works better after most guests have arrived. Balloon sculpting or face painting can work nicely at the start or end because children can take turns.

You do not need to plan every minute perfectly, but having a simple flow helps everyone feel more relaxed.


7. What do parents need to prepare before the entertainer arrives?

Most entertainers will bring what they need for their own activity. But a little preparation from parents can make the setup smoother.

Helpful things to prepare:

  • A clear activity area for the show or games
  • A small table for balloons, face painting or props
  • A space / mat for children to sit if there is a magic show
  • A nearby power point if music or sound is needed
  • A contact person on the event day
  • Cake timing so the party does not feel rushed
  • Prizes or goodie bags, if you are preparing them separately

For home and condo parties, it is also useful to keep the food table slightly away from the activity area. Children can get distracted very easily when snacks are right beside them.

A simple setup often works best. You do not need to over-decorate or over-plan every minute.
